Leicestershire County Council is hiring a Volunteer Development Officer based in Leicestershire. The role involves leading the recruitment, training, and management of volunteers to support the Targeted Family Help Service.

Candidates should have qualifications or relevant experience working with families and volunteers, excellent organizational skills, and knowledge of child development. Key requirements include a driving license and experience of working in community settings. Flexible working options may be available.
